What is the vSphere Assessment Tool?
The vSphere Assessment Tool (vSAT) is a powerful tool that allows you to review your current vSphere environment before upgrading to a new release. The tool provides a comprehensive assessment of your environment, including hardware, software, and configuration details. This information can then be used to make informed decisions about your upgrade path and ensure a smooth transition to the latest version of vSphere.
Features of the vSphere Assessment Tool
The vSphere Assessment Tool offers a wide range of features that can help you streamline your vSphere upgrade process. Some of the key features include:
1. Environment Assessment: The vSAT provides a comprehensive assessment of your current environment, including hardware, software, and configuration details.
2. Compatibility Checking: The tool checks for compatibility between your current environment and the latest version of vSphere, ensuring that you can upgrade with confidence.
3. Recommendations and Best Practices: The vSAT provides recommendations and best practices for upgrading to the latest version of vSphere, based on your specific environment and requirements.
4. Customizable Reports: The tool allows you to generate customized reports based on your specific needs, providing a detailed overview of your environment and upgrade recommendations.
